Output 507529d7f39acc30685cc31c14dc2c9aaea086a7f82a6aca20f4d796e1825680:0

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53ab0ad314ead06dce64e115d8ba05adb1dfc74e OP_EQUALVERIFY OP_CHECKSIG
address
18dPz9bGKQgf4Dei2y3FzEzYuUHag5Br1f
transaction
507529d7f39acc30685cc31c14dc2c9aaea086a7f82a6aca20f4d796e1825680
confirmations
460371
spent
false

1 Sat Range